vestibule of vagina
Type: Term Definitions: 1. the space posterior to the glans clitoridis and between the labia minora, containing the openings of the vagina, urethra, and ducts of the greater vestibular glands. Synonyms: vestibulum vaginae, vaginal introitus, vestibulum pudendi Found op http://www.medilexicon.com/medicaldictionary.php?t=98528
